Best Schools in Thetford Center, MI
Thetford Center, MI has a total of 13 schools including 5 high schools, 3 middle schools and 5 elementary schools. A total of 5,043 students attend Thetford Center, MI schools. On average, schools in Thetford Center score 22%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 24%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Thetford Center don't me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Thetford Center, MI
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Thetford Center, MI has a total population of 2,677 with 17%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 90%, and 12%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
